+#include <string.h>
+
+#include "coap_resource.h"
+#include "coap_api.h"
+#include "iot_common.h"
+#include "sdk_config.h"
+
+#define COAP_RESOURCE_MAX_AGE_INIFINITE 0xFFFFFFFF
+
+static coap_resource_t * mp_root_resource = NULL;
+static char m_scratch_buffer[(COAP_RESOURCE_MAX_NAME_LEN + 1) * COAP_RESOURCE_MAX_DEPTH + 6];
+
+#if (COAP_DISABLE_API_PARAM_CHECK == 0)
+
+/**@brief Verify NULL parameters are not passed to API by application. */
+#define NULL_PARAM_CHECK(PARAM) \
+ if ((PARAM) == NULL) \
+ { \
+ return (NRF_ERROR_NULL | IOT_COAP_ERR_BASE); \
+ }
+#else
+
+#define NULL_PARAM_CHECK(PARAM)
+
+#endif // COAP_DISABLE_API_PARAM_CHECK
+
+uint32_t coap_resource_init(void)
+{
+ mp_root_resource = NULL;
+ return NRF_SUCCESS;
+}
+
+uint32_t coap_resource_create(coap_resource_t * p_resource, const char * name)
+{
+ NULL_PARAM_CHECK(p_resource);
+ NULL_PARAM_CHECK(name);
+
+ if (strlen(name) > COAP_RESOURCE_MAX_NAME_LEN)
+ {
+ return (NRF_ERROR_DATA_SIZE | IOT_COAP_ERR_BASE);
+ }
+
+ memcpy(p_resource->name, name, strlen(name));
+
+ if (mp_root_resource == NULL)
+ {
+ mp_root_resource = p_resource;
+ }
+
+ p_resource->max_age = COAP_RESOURCE_MAX_AGE_INIFINITE;
+
+ return NRF_SUCCESS;
+}
+
+uint32_t coap_resource_child_add(coap_resource_t * p_parent, coap_resource_t * p_child)
+{
+ NULL_PARAM_CHECK(p_parent);
+ NULL_PARAM_CHECK(p_child);
+
+ if (p_parent->child_count == 0)
+ {
+ p_parent->p_front = p_child;
+ p_parent->p_tail = p_child;
+ }
+ else
+ {
+ coap_resource_t * p_last_sibling = p_parent->p_tail;
+ p_last_sibling->p_sibling = p_child;
+ p_parent->p_tail = p_child;
+ }
+
+ p_parent->child_count++;
+
+ return NRF_SUCCESS;
+}
+
+static uint32_t generate_path(uint16_t buffer_pos, coap_resource_t * p_current_resource, char * parent_path, uint8_t * string, uint16_t * length)
+{
+ uint32_t err_code = NRF_SUCCESS;
+
+ if (parent_path == NULL)
+ {
+ m_scratch_buffer[buffer_pos++] = '<';
+
+ if (p_current_resource->p_front != NULL)
+ {
+ coap_resource_t * next_child = p_current_resource->p_front;
+ do
+ {
+ err_code = generate_path(buffer_pos, next_child, m_scratch_buffer, string, length);
+ if (err_code != NRF_SUCCESS)
+ {
+ return err_code;
+ }
+ next_child = next_child->p_sibling;
+ } while (next_child != NULL);
+ }
+ }
+ else
+ {
+ uint16_t size = strlen(p_current_resource->name);
+ m_scratch_buffer[buffer_pos++] = '/';
+
+ memcpy(&m_scratch_buffer[buffer_pos], p_current_resource->name, size);
+ buffer_pos += size;
+
+ if (p_current_resource->p_front != NULL)
+ {
+ coap_resource_t * next_child = p_current_resource->p_front;
+ do
+ {
+ err_code = generate_path(buffer_pos, next_child, m_scratch_buffer, string, length);
+ if (err_code != NRF_SUCCESS)
+ {
+ return err_code;
+ }
+ next_child = next_child->p_sibling;
+ } while (next_child != NULL);
+ }
+
+ m_scratch_buffer[buffer_pos++] = '>';
+
+ // If the resource is observable, append 'obs;' token.
+ if ((p_current_resource->permission & COAP_PERM_OBSERVE) > 0)
+ {
+ memcpy(&m_scratch_buffer[buffer_pos], ";obs", 4);
+ buffer_pos += 4;
+ }
+
+ m_scratch_buffer[buffer_pos++] = ',';
+
+ if (buffer_pos <= (*length))
+ {
+ *length -= buffer_pos;
+ memcpy(&string[strlen((char *)string)], m_scratch_buffer, buffer_pos);
+ }
+ else
+ {
+ return (NRF_ERROR_DATA_SIZE | IOT_COAP_ERR_BASE);
+ }
+ }
+
+ return err_code;
+}
+
+uint32_t coap_resource_well_known_generate(uint8_t * string, uint16_t * length)
+{
+ NULL_PARAM_CHECK(string);
+ NULL_PARAM_CHECK(length);
+
+ if (mp_root_resource == NULL)
+ {
+ return (NRF_ERROR_INVALID_STATE | IOT_COAP_ERR_BASE);
+ }
+
+ memset(string, 0, *length);
+
+ uint32_t err_code = generate_path(0, mp_root_resource, NULL, string, length);
+
+ string[strlen((char *)string) - 1] = '\0'; // remove the last comma
+
+ return err_code;
+}
+
+static coap_resource_t * coap_resource_child_resolve(coap_resource_t * p_parent,
+ char * p_path)
+{
+ coap_resource_t * result = NULL;
+ if (p_parent->p_front != NULL)
+ {
+ coap_resource_t * sibling_in_question = p_parent->p_front;
+
+ do {
+ // Check if the sibling name match.
+ size_t size = strlen(sibling_in_question->name);
+ if (strncmp(sibling_in_question->name, p_path, size) == 0)
+ {
+ return sibling_in_question;
+ }
+ else
+ {
+ sibling_in_question = sibling_in_question->p_sibling;
+ }
+ } while (sibling_in_question != NULL);
+ }
+ return result;
+}
+
+uint32_t coap_resource_get(coap_resource_t ** p_resource, uint8_t ** pp_uri_pointers, uint8_t num_of_uris)
+{
+ if (mp_root_resource == NULL)
+ {
+ // Make sure pointer is set to NULL before returning.
+ *p_resource = NULL;
+ return (NRF_ERROR_INVALID_STATE | IOT_COAP_ERR_BASE);
+ }
+
+ coap_resource_t * p_current_resource = mp_root_resource;
+
+ // Every node should start at root.
+ for (uint8_t i = 0; i < num_of_uris; i++)
+ {
+ p_current_resource = coap_resource_child_resolve(p_current_resource, (char *)pp_uri_pointers[i]);
+
+ if (p_current_resource == NULL)
+ {
+ // Stop looping as this direction will not give anything more.
+ break;
+ }
+ }
+
+ if (p_current_resource != NULL)
+ {
+ *p_resource = p_current_resource;
+ return NRF_SUCCESS;
+ }
+
+ // If nothing has been found.
+ *p_resource = NULL;
+ return (NRF_ERROR_NOT_FOUND | IOT_COAP_ERR_BASE);
+}
+
+uint32_t coap_resource_root_get(coap_resource_t ** pp_resource)
+{
+ NULL_PARAM_CHECK(pp_resource);
+
+ if (mp_root_resource == NULL)
+ {
+ return (NRF_ERROR_NOT_FOUND | IOT_COAP_ERR_BASE);
+ }
+
+ *pp_resource = mp_root_resource;
+
+ return NRF_SUCCESS;
+}
